As his vital energy was continuously drained, Wang Ye's expression changed slightly.

Xiao Si next to him stared at the blood flowing from Wang Ye's wrist, and a trace of human desire emerged on her stiff face.

Then, she suddenly opened her mouth and swallowed the blood flow into her belly.

The feeling of restraint disappeared, and Wang Ye breathed a sigh of relief. He subconsciously glanced at Xiao Si, only to find that she had reverted to her original calm self.

The old man, on the other hand, was somewhat angry at this moment. He abruptly appeared in front of Wang Ye and stretched out his index finger to poke Wang Ye's forehead.

Wang Ye's body instantly became stiff, making even moving difficult. He could only watch the old man's finger getting closer and closer to his forehead.

A breath of death surrounded him.

"Am I finally going to die?"

Wang Ye's eyes became somewhat distracted. After being reborn into this new life, he still couldn't escape the fate of death.

Moreover...

He would die a little earlier this time.

If he was an ordinary person, he might have lived a little longer.

It sounded somewhat ridiculous.

This old ghost was frighteningly powerful...

But suddenly, a bald man appeared in front of him!

Xiao Wu's wig had fallen off at some point, revealing his huge bald head. Without any hesitation, he blocked Wang Ye.

The next second, the old ghost's finger landed on Xiao Wu's body.

His face instantly turned pale as he spit out a mouthful of blood and fainted.

"Xiao Wu..."

Wang Ye's gaze refocused as he looked at Xiao Wu's back, his expression complex.

Was there really someone who would stand in front of him between life and death?

"Old ghost!"

Seeing the old ghost grabbing Xiao Wu's neck, Wang Ye's eyes instantly turned blood red. His whole body was filled with a violent aura as his reason receded.

At this moment, the Ancient Domain was on the verge of shattering!

A wisp of black flame had appeared between Wang Ye's eyebrows at some point. His eyes were cold, like a demon escaping from the Nine Netherworlds!

The next second, he drew out his Ghost Blade, slashing at the old ghost's arm with an icy edge.

The arm fell silently. Xiao Wu's body softened and was about to fall to the ground, but was caught by Wang Ye.

At this moment, the blood aura around Wang Ye's body suddenly dropped a notch.

The black flame between his eyebrows also disappeared in an instant, and his eyes gradually regained their sanity.

Dragging Xiao Wu, Wang Ye frantically retreated to stand at the exit of the crack. He deeply etched the old ghost's face into his mind before turning around and diving out.

Xiao Si, who had been silent all along, followed Wang Ye and left together.

And at this moment, the Ancient Domain completely collapsed and fell into darkness.

The old ghost silently picked up his severed hand and reattached it, looking somewhat sluggish.

The door of the only bedroom in Building 4 suddenly opened, and a woman in a cheongsam and mask emerged abruptly.

At this moment, the four buildings became somewhat illusory and disappeared into the Ancient Domain.

The soil in the small garden churned as a huge bronze door emerged from the ground. The door was open, filled with silence, gloom and terror.

And to the side of the door, the bloody word "ghost" was written in seal script!

The woman in the cheongsam stood still for a long time in front of the bronze door before stepping in.

Seeing the bronze door, the old ghost's eyes were filled with a trace of fear as he kept retreating backwards.

Finally, the bronze door slowly closed and sank back into the ground.

The crack at the exit also gradually healed, completely cutting off the Ancient Domain's connection with the outside world.

The moment he stepped out of the Ancient Domain, Wang Ye knelt down on the ground.

Xiao Si stood silently by Wang Ye's side, motionless.

Xiao Wu had fallen unconscious.

Although this trip to the Ancient Domain yielded huge gains, it was also extremely dangerous. Being able to escape from the old ghost's hands was an extremely lucky fluke.

At this time, over ten paranormal investigators from the action team had surrounded Wang Ye's neighborhood, which was not far from the exit of the Ancient Domain. Su Changqing was leading them.

Li Hongtian and Mao Yong'an's whereabouts were unknown. Seeing Wang Ye and the other two come out and the Ancient Domain closing directly, Su Changqing's expression changed!

The Inspector was still inside!

Was he dead?

His eyes kept flickering, gloomy and uncertain!

Only the Inspector knew his identity in the Qingfeng Stockade, including all his weaknesses.

If the Inspector died in the Ancient Domain, it would give him a chance to continue working for the Qingfeng Stockade, or... completely turn to the Tian Group!

Glancing at Wang Ye with some hesitation...

After much deliberation, Su Changqing said, "Go save people!"

Following Su Changqing's order, a group of action team members quickly helped Wang Ye up and brought over a chair, while also handing him a bottle of water.

Two doctors immediately took out a bunch of instruments and kept examining Xiao Wu and Wang Ye's physical condition.

In an instant, he had already made up his mind!

In the Qingfeng Stockade, he was just a villager. Even if he contacted the stockade, a new Inspector would be sent, and he would still be just a pawn!

But...

In the Tian Group, he would be second to none!

As for the Inspector having a few women and an illegitimate child in Beijing, killing them all...

From now on, he would be Su Changqing of the Tian Group!

Ignoring Wang Ye, Su Changqing turned and left. With the Ancient Domain closed, there was no need to stay here anymore.

...

At this moment.

Countless paranormal investigators were shuttling back and forth in Beijing.

One after another, Buddha Kingdom spies were dragged out from their own beds and directly killed without hesitation!

A murderous aura permeated the entire Beijing on this day.

Sitting in his office, Zhang ZiLiang looked at the constantly updating intelligence and murmured, "Su Changqing, is it really okay..."

"Wang Ye, as expected, returned alive!"

As if suddenly recalling something, he looked up at Yang Chen standing beside him, "Right, send someone to clean up Wang Ye's neighbors on the 6th floor of Xingfu Community. They really are too abnormal."

"Living with a bunch of ghosts as neighbors must have been hard on him."

Yang Chen flipped his long flowing hair and turned to leave.

Since becoming a twice awakened, his whole aura had undergone considerable change.

No more sarcasm, no more nonsense!

Just like... Li Hongtian.

Walking the invincible path, cultivating the invincible mind!

After all, it seems, probably... Twice awakened were also considered experts in the Tian Group...right?
